asText: Return the Well-Known Text (WKT) representation
asBinary: Return the Well-Known Binary (WKB) representation
asHexWKB: Return the Hexadecimal Well-Known Binary (HexWKB) representation as text
asMFJSON: Return the Moving Features JSON (MF-JSON) representation
ttypeFromBinary: Input from a Well-Known Binary (WKB) representation
ttypeFromHexWKB: Input from an Hexadecimal Well-Known Binary (HexWKB) representation
ttypeFromMFJSON: Input from a Moving Features JSON (MF-JSON) representation
ttype: Constructor for temporal types from a base value and a time value
ttypeSeq: Constructor for temporal types of sequence subtype
ttypeSeqSet, ttypeSeqSetGaps: Constructor for temporal types of sequence set subtype
ttype::tstzspan, tnumber::{numspan,tbox}, tpoint::stbox: Convert a temporal value to a bounding box
tint::tfloat, tfloat::tint: Convert between a temporal integer and a temporal float
tgeompoint::tgeogpoint, tgeogpoint::tgeompoint: Convert between a temporal geometry point and a temporal geography point
tgeompoint::geometry, tgeogpoint::geography, geometry::tgeompoint, geography::tgeogpoint: Convert between a temporal point and a PostGIS trajectory
memSize: Return the memory size in bytes
tempSubtype: Return the temporal subtype
interp: Return the interpolation
getValue, getTimestamp: Return the value or the timestamp of an instant
getValues, getTime: Return the values or the time on which the temporal value is defined
valueSpan, timeSpan: Return the value or time span
valueSet: Return the values of the temporal number as a set
startValue, endValue, valueN: Return the start, end, or n-th value
minValue, maxValue: Return the minimum or maximum value
minInstant, maxInstant: Return the instant with the minimum or maximum value
valueAtTimestamp: Return the value at a timestamp
duration: Return the duration
lowerInc, upperInc: Is the start/end instant inclusive?
numInstants: Return the number of different instants
startInstant, endInstant, instantN: Return the start, end, or n-th instant
instants: Return the different instants
numTimestamps: Return the number of different timestamps
startTimestamp, endTimestamp, timestampN: Return the start, end, or n-th timestamp
timestamps: Return the different timestamps
numSequences: Return the number of sequences
startSequence, endSequence, sequenceN: Return the start, end, or n-th sequence
sequences: Return the sequences
segments: Return the segments
integral: Return the area under the curve
twAvg: Return the time-weighted average
ttypeInst, ttypeSeq, ttypeSeqSet: Transform a temporal value to another subtype
setInterp: Transform a temporal value to another interpolation
shiftValue, shiftTime: Shift the value or time span of the temporal value by a value or interval
scaleValue, scaleTime: Scale the value or time span of the temporal value to a value or interval
shiftScaleValue, shiftScaleTime: Shift and scale the value or time span the temporal value with the values or intervals
stops: Extract from a temporal sequence (set) with linear interpolation the subsequences where the objects stays within an area with a given maximum size for at least the specified duration.
unnest: Transform a nonlinear temporal value into a set of rows, each one containing a base value and a period set during which the temporal value has the base value
insert: Insert a temporal value into another one
update: Update a temporal value with another one
deleteTime: Delete the instants of a temporal value that intersect a time value
appendInstant: Append a temporal instant to a temporal value
appendSequence: Append a temporal sequence to a temporal value
merge: Merge temporal values
atValues, minusValues: Restrict to (the complement of) a set of values
atMin, minusMin: Restrict to (the complement of) the minimum value
atMax, minusMax: Restrict to (the complement of) the maximum value
atGeometry, minusGeometry, atGeometryTime, minusGeometryTime: Restrict to (the complement of) a geometry, a Z span, and/or a period
atTime, minusTime: Restrict to (the complement of) a time value
atTbox, minusTbox: Restrict to (the complement of) a tbox
atStbox, minusStbox: Restrict to (the complement of) an stbox
=: Are the temporal values equal?
<>: Are the temporal values different?
<: Is the first temporal value less than the second one?
>: Is the first temporal value greater than the second one?
<=: Is the first temporal value less than or equal to the second one?
>=: Is the first temporal value greater than or equal to the second one?
?=, %=: Is the temporal value ever or always equal to the value?
?<>, %<>: Is the temporal value ever or always different from the value?
?<, %<: Is the temporal value ever or always less than the value?
?>, %>: Is the temporal value ever or always greater than the value?
?<=, %<=: Is the temporal value ever or always less than or equal to the value?
?>=, %>=: Is the temporal value ever or always greater than or equal to the value?
